Collection Services Requirements. The collection services requirements listed below provide a detailed listing of the minimum requirements the City expects the Delinquent Collection Services Vendor to satisfy. The guidance outlined in this RFP is not intended to preclude Vendors from recommending alternative solutions or approaches offering comparable or better performance or value to the 3.1 The Vendor shall document and maintain the applicable internal processes, procedures, forms, templates, scripts, etc. at all times during the term of this Agreement. Vendor shall provide a copy of these documents to the Director no later than 30 days after the Effective Date of this Agreement. The documents may be modified by mutual consent of the Director and the Vendor. It is recognized by the Parties that the Vendor may, at its option and expense, perform additional collection efforts in addition to, but not inconsistent with these required processes and standards.
